North Yorkshire Hospice Care (known to its local communities as either Saint Michael’s Hospice, Herriot Hospice or Just ‘B’) has a great opportunity for someone to join their fabulous Fundraising Team as a Relationship Fundraiser. If you are energetic, passionate, and looking to develop a career in fundraising whilst ensuring everyone has access to local hospice care, emotional wellbeing and bereavement support, this role is for you.

This is an excellent opportunity for proactive candidates with experience working within Individual Giving, In Memory or Legacy giving, to work in a growing area of the charity. With a varied workload, as a Relationship Fundraiser you will help secure a crucial source of income for the charity.

The Relationship Fundraiser will cultivate and manage relationships with both internal and external stakeholders, as well as individual donors, to ensure a positive experience for all supporters of North Yorkshire Hospice Care. Each day in this role will be unique, involving activities such as planning upcoming appeals, meeting with recently bereaved families, or promoting the importance of legacy gifts. This position is ideal for someone who enjoys building relationships and has a keen eye for detail.

We are looking for individuals who are personable, have a positive attitude, and can empathise with stakeholders.

Key responsibilities will include –

Supporting in-memorium donors through their giving journey
Help the creation of regular giving appeals
Grow income and support donor stewardship from general donations received
Be an ambassador for legacy giving, growing awareness internally and building number of legacy pledgers
Build and maintain strong, personal relationships with stakeholders to ensure life-time giving
Work with the team across the other fundraising specialisms to contribute to a cohesive approach to fundraising
